The two-volume set CCIS 2179 + 2180 constitutes the refereed proceedings of the 31st European Conference on Systems, Software and Services Process Improvement, EuroSPI 2024, held in Munich, Germany, during September 2024. 





The 55 papers included in these proceedings were carefully reviewed and selected from 100 submissions. They were organized in topical sections as follows:





Part I: SPI and Emerging and Multidisciplinary Approaches to Software Engineering; SPI and Functional Safety and Cybersecurity; SPI and Standards and Safety and Security Norms; 





Part II: Sustainability and Life Cycle Challenges; SPI and Recent Innovations; Digitalisation of Industry, Infrastructure and E-Mobility; SPI and Agile; SPI and Good/Bad SPI Practices in Improvement.
